Job Title: Sales & Marketing Administrator

Duration: Permanent / Full Time (flexible working hours)

Location: Solihull (or Chepstow), UK (Hybrid)

Responsible to: Group Marketing Manager / Chief Growth Officer-Sales


Job Function

The Solution Sales & Marketing Administrator will play a pivotal role in supporting the commercial success of TXO's Solutions & Services business.

Working closely with Sales, Marketing, Engineering, and Operations teams, you'll coordinate marketing campaigns, prepare customer proposals, maintain CRM data, support lead generation activities, organize customer events, and ensure our sales processes run efficiently.

This role is ideal for someone who enjoys working across multiple projects, has excellent attention to detail, and wants to develop a career within technology sales and marketing.


Specific Responsibilities

The following outlines the primary areas of responsibility. Additional responsibilities or functions may be required as necessary to support the business.

Sales Administration

  • Support the Solutions Sales team with day-to-day administrative activities.
  • Prepare customer-facing proposals, presentations, and documentation.
  • Support creation and maintenance of Solutions Sales opportunities with daily/weekly updates to Sales Lead, ISAM Lead & CGO with HubSpot CRM.
  • Produce any required weekly reports and KPI dashboards.
  • Coordinate customer meetings, agendas, and follow-up actions.
  • Support Account Planning Meetings with all Global Account Director, managing Actions Log, acting as the interface with Marketing/Comms and Sales to ensure actions completed on-time and information provided to customers.
  • Support with Sales All Hands & Lunch and Learn internal communications with the coordination of attendees, speakers/presenters.
  • Assist with contract administration and document management.
  • Track customer renewals and commercial opportunities.

Marketing Support

  • Coordinate marketing campaigns alongside the Group Marketing team.
  • Assist with email marketing campaigns and customer communications.
  • Update website content and marketing collateral where required.
  • Manage case studies, brochures, and product information.
  • Coordinate social media content for the Solutions business.
  • Organize webinars, exhibitions, and customer events.
  • Maintain mailing lists and marketing databases.
  • Support branding and campaign consistency across all customer touchpoints.

Lead Generation Support

  • Assist with inbound enquiry management.
  • Conduct basic market research and competitor analysis.
  • Identify potential target customers across telecoms, enterprise, and technology sectors.
  • Support outbound sales campaigns.
  • Monitor campaign performance and report on results.

Commercial Support

  • Produce customer presentations using Microsoft PowerPoint.
  • Assist with bid submissions and tender documentation.
  • Coordinate internal approval processes.
  • Maintain pricing documentation.
  • Support forecasting activities.
  • Generate monthly sales performance reports.

Customer Experience

  • Act as a first point of contact for customer enquiries.
  • Coordinate customer communications.
  • Ensure excellent customer service throughout the sales cycle.
  • Work collaboratively with Engineering, Operations, and Finance teams to deliver outstanding customer experiences.

About You

Essential

  • Previous experience in a Sales Administrator, Commercial Administrator, Marketing Administrator, or Sales Support role.
  • Excellent organizational and administrative skills.
  • Strong Microsoft Office skills (Excel, Word, and PowerPoint).
  • Experience using CRM systems (HubSpot, Salesforce, or similar).
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ities simultaneously.
  • High attention to detail.
  • Commercial awareness.
  • Strong interpersonal skills.
  • Self-motivated with a proactive approach.

Desirable

  • Experience within telecommunications, technology, IT, or engineering industries.
  • Previous marketing administration experience.
  • Knowledge of digital marketing platforms.
  • Experience supporting exhibitions or events.
  • Basic graphic design skills (Canva or Adobe Creative Suite).
  • Experience using ERP systems.
  • Understanding of sustainability or circular economy principles.

Qualifications

  • GCSE (or equivalent) including English and Mathematics.
  • Business Administration, Marketing, or related qualification desirable.
  • CIM qualification (or working towards) advantageous.

Rewards

  • Competitive basic salary
  • Life insurance
  • Company pension
  • 25 days holiday (plus bank holidays)
  • Employee assistance programme
  • Company events
  • Cycle to work scheme
  • On-site free parking
  • Hybrid working
